Understanding Vehicle Keys
Before diving into the replacement process, it is important to comprehend the kinds of vehicle keys offered. Keys differ widely depending upon the vehicle's make, model, and year.
Kinds Of Vehicle Keys
Conventional Keys: These are simple metal keys that do not include any electronic parts.

[transponder key](https://www.rahulmcmillan.top/automotive/unlocking-convenience-your-local-solution-for-replacement-car-key/) Keys: These keys have a chip embedded within them. They communicate with the vehicle's ignition system, improving security against theft.

Smart Keys: Smart keys allow for keyless entry and starting of the vehicle. They operate with a fob and often use proximity sensors.

Key Fobs: These are remote devices that control the vehicle's locking system and may consist of additional functions like remote start and panic buttons.

The procedure of changing a lost vehicle key will vary depending on the type of key and the vehicle's manufacturer. Below are basic actions to follow if one finds themselves in this bothersome scenario.
1. Evaluate the SituationLook for a spare key. If you have one, the issue may be solved quickly.Double-check all possible places where the key may be hiding.2. Contact Your Vehicle Manufacturer or DealershipIf a spare key is unavailable, call the dealership or manufacturer. They can direct you on the next actions.Have your vehicle identification number (VIN) all set. This number is crucial for validating ownership.3. Programming the KeyDepending on the kind of key, setting it to deal with your vehicle may be needed. This action is very important for transponder and wise keys. Ensure that the person producing the key has the needed devices to configure it effectively.5. Test the New [key replacement car](https://www.anika.top/automotive/the-ultimate-guide-to-finding-car-key-replacement-near-me/)Once the key is developed and programmed, test it to confirm that it functions effectively with your vehicle's ignition and locking system.6. Consider Additional Security MeasuresIf you lost a transponder or wise key, consider reprogramming or replacing the ignition system to make sure nobody else has access to your vehicle.Cost Considerations
The expense of changing a lost vehicle key can differ depending on a number of aspects, including the key type, programs requirements, and the selected company (dealer vs. locksmith).
